The Study Physician (SP) is a critical global role that is created to take up medical responsibilities of clinical trials within Clinical Development & Operations by a qualified and clinically experienced physician. The SP is medically responsible at the trial level throughout the preparation, conduct and reporting phase of clinical trial. During the clinical trial, SP is responsible to provide state-of-the-art medical expertise to fully execute medical oversight from the Trial Design Outline (TDO) kick off to the Clinical Trial Report (CTR). SP is a core member of the Trial Team and the Evidence Network Team.
Trial Start-Up
Responsible for medical content of Clinical Trial Protocols (CTPs), in line with TDO, in collaboration with the Clinical Trial Lead (CTL), Clinical Program Lead (CPL), Patient Safety Physician, Medical Writer and other trial and evidence team members to ensure high medical quality CTP. Medical input into CTP updates.
Contribution to trial risk-based quality management from medical perspective, by defining medically relevant critical data/processes, related risks, and its mitigation/monitoring strategies in the Integrated Quality and Risk Management Plan (IQRMP) as well as in risk discussions during trial conduct.
Responsible for providing medical input into the definition of important protocol deviations (iPD), providing input for compilation and review of trial iPD list from medical perspective, and support trial team in deciding on iPDs from identified potential iPDs.
Medical input into Data Management documentation for the trial, such as eCRF design by efficient translation of medical questions into electronic data capturing, “Information for CRF completion” (ICC), Data Review Plan (e.g.,propose items such as data screening rules for automated data queries, automated or manual data checks for clinical data consistency), laboratory parameters specifications for the project, Data Transfer Agreement, central laboratory alerts.
Responsible for the medical content of Patient Information and Informed Consent, Trial Level Monitoring Manual, Trial Communication Plan, Trial Training Plan, and Trial Statistical Analysis Plan.
